Man, 24, Commits Suicide in Sky Diving Jump

A man committed suicide after taking a six-hour sky diving class by deliberately slipping out of his parachute’s harness during his descent, officials said Tuesday.

Sheriff’s investigators said a note was found on the body of Abdoulreza Khatibipour, 24, who recently moved to California from Massachusetts. It said he was unhappy and wanted to go to heaven.

After leaping from the plane, Khatibipour dumped his helmet, slipped out of his parachute’s harness and fell 500 to 700 feet to his death, authorities said.

Bill Gere, owner of Adventure Aerosports, said Khatibipour arrived in a taxicab at his parachute school in San Benito County, about 80 miles south of San Francisco, paying $171 for the fare.
